OPINION! Deep dish pizza isn't pizza, it's casserole. Or some kind of savory pie. Not pizza.
Hm. See, I make pies, and the thing with pies is, they all have crisco/butter/fat crusts. Chicken pot pies, mince pies, all of them, even quiche. Deep-dish pizza has the shape of a pie, and I think most old-school Italians will still call it a pie, but the crust is made of yeast dough.
So I would call deep-dish pizza still in the pizza family, despite its obvious oddity and deliciousness. Because if you took a pie crust, and made a deep-dish pizza out of it, it would taste very, very wrong.
